A woman is in a critical condition after being allegedly assaulted and run over in Sydney’s south-west this morning.

Authorities were alerted to a residence in Narellan Vale early in the morning, approximately around 8:30 a.m., where they discovered a 36-year-old woman suffering from numerous injuries. Emergency services promptly administered treatment at the scene before she was airlifted to Liverpool Hospital. Her condition remains critical, and suspicions have arisen that this may be a case of domestic violence.

Following this distressing discovery, police initiated an investigation. Within a few hours, at about 11:00 a.m., they apprehended a 36-year-old man at a phone booth located near Camden Valley Way. He was subsequently taken to the Narellan Vale Police Station for questioning, although formal charges have yet to be filed against him.
